Hwang, Wu-Yuin; Utami, Ika Qutsiati; Purba, Siska Wati Dewi; Chen, Holly S. L. – IEEE Transactions on Learning Technologies, 2020
This paper aimed to investigate the effect of a mobile app on mathematics learning in authentic contexts. Authentic contexts contain rich resources wherein students can use authentic objects as aid in advanced educational technology-assisted mathematics learning. We designed Ubiquitous-Fraction (U-Fraction), a mobile application that helps…

Tsai, Shu-Chiao – Australasian Journal of Educational Technology, 2013
This study reports on integrating courseware for participating in international trade fairs into English for specific purposes (ESP) instruction at a technical university in Taiwan. An Information and Communication Technology (ICT) approach combining courseware integration with Task Based Learning (TBL), was adopted. Evaluation of implementing…
